How to decode a 1994 Ford Probe VIN

Characters 1-3 of a 1994 Ford Probe VIN

World Manufacturer Identifiers (WMIs) are unique codes assigned to every vehicle manufacturer. They form the initial characters of the Vehicle Identification Number (VIN), specifying the manufacturer, vehicle type, and the country of manufacture. For instance, the WMI for a 1994 Ford Probe, manufactured by Auto Alliance International in the USA, is “1ZV”. This code indicates that the vehicle is a passenger car produced in the United States. Such identifiers play a critical role in tracking, identification, and registration of vehicles globally.

Characters 4-8 are the Vehicle Descriptor Section (VDS) of a 1994 Ford Probe VIN

These characters correspond to components like:

  • Engine type
  • Transmission
  • Model or trim
  • Body style
  • Gross vehicle weight range

Character 9 is the “check digit” in a 1994 Ford Probe VIN.

Based on a formula developed by the US Department of Transportation, it helps reduce fraud by ensuring the validity of the VIN.

VIN Characters 12 - 17 of a 1994 Ford Probe

The final 6 characters in a 1994 Ford Probe’s 17-digit VIN are its serial number, which will be unique to every vehicle.

How to find a 1994 Ford Probe’s VIN?

Locating the VIN number on your 1994 Ford Probe is key for identification. Here’s how to find it:

  1. Examine the dashboard on the driver’s side of your 1994 Ford Probe, visible through the windshield on a small metal or plastic plate.
  2. Look at the door frame or door post of the driver’s side door for a label when the door is open on your Ford Probe.
  3. Check under the hood; the VIN may be stamped onto the engine block or a metal plate on the Ford Probe.
  4. Inspect the rear wheel well above the tire; the VIN might sometimes be found in this area on a Ford Probe.
  5. If you have access to the car’s documents, the VIN should be printed on the vehicle’s title, registration, or insurance papers.

Sample VIN Decode Report for a 1994 Ford Probe

Vehicle Spec Value
Body Class Hatchback/Liftback/Notchback
Displacement (CC) 2490.833728
Displacement (CI) 152
Displacement (L) 2.5
Doors 2
Engine Brake (hp) From 160
Engine Brake (hp) To 164
Engine Configuration V-Shaped
Engine Manufacturer Mazda
Engine Number of Cylinders 6
Front Air Bag Locations 1st Row (Driver and Passenger)
Fuel Type - Primary Gasoline
Gross Vehicle Weight Rating From Class 1: 6,000 lb or less (2,722 kg or less)
Gross Vehicle Weight Rating To Class 1: 6,000 lb or less (2,722 kg or less)
Model Probe
Model Year 1994
Other Engine Info EFI: Electronic Fuel Injection
Plant City Flat Rock
Plant Company Name AAI
Plant Country United States
Plant State Michigan
Seat Belt Type Manual
Series GT
Valve Train Design Dual Overhead Cam (DOHC)
Vehicle Descriptor 1ZVLT22B*R5
Vehicle Type Passenger Car
Sample_VIN 1ZVLT22B2R5157671
